Jeff Bezos and Lauren Sánchez tied the knot in what many are calling the “wedding of the year,” hosting a three-day celebration in Venice, Italy, that glittered with the presence of A-listers and global business tycoons. Despite local protests over rising wealth inequality, the Amazon founder and award-winning journalist went ahead with their lavish plans, reportedly spending tens of millions on the ceremony.
The festivities began on Friday, June 27, and wrapped up on Saturday, June 28, with a grand finale featuring performances by music legends Elton John and Lady Gaga at a historic medieval shipyard. Guests included billionaire Bill Gates, Oprah Winfrey, Leonardo DiCaprio, Tom Brady, Orlando Bloom with model Vittoria Ceretti, and members of the Kardashian-Jenner clan including Kim, Khloé, Kendall, Kylie, and Kris Jenner.
Sources indicate the total cost of the wedding may have soared past $50 million. Originally estimated between €20 and €30 million ($23–$34 million), the final figure rose to between €40 and €48 million ($46.5–$55.6 million) following a last-minute venue change due to security concerns, as reported by Reuters and USA Today.
The bride, 55-year-old Sánchez, stunned in a custom high-necked Dolce & Gabbana gown featuring 180 silk chiffon-covered buttons and a romantic tulle-and-lace veil, according to Vogue. The entire affair was a spectacle of style, wealth, and high-profile reunions, even as it sparked criticism from activists calling for Bezos to pay more taxes.
Bezos, 61, and Sánchez first went public with their relationship in 2019, shortly after announcing separations from their previous partners. Bezos shares four children with ex-wife MacKenzie Scott, while Sánchez co-parents two children with ex-husband Patrick Whitesell and has a son with former NFL star Tony Gonzalez.
Though intensely private about some details, the couple’s wedding has become a symbol of luxury and spectacle in the age of billionaire romance.
